如何优雅地使用git?

简介: 如何优雅地使用git?

Oh shit git

https://ohshitgit.com/

这个网站针对一些在使用git中可能遇到的问题都做了详细介绍,并且形象生动。

例如:Oh shit,我想改个地方,但我已经提交(commited)了咋办?

首先,添加下当前已改动的代码

git add .

然后,运行下面这条命令,它就会把你刚刚添加的代码合并到最后一次提交上了:

git commit --amend

官网的其它例子:

gitmoji

https://gitmoji.dev/

Gitmoji 是一个标准化 Git commit 的工具。在提交消息中使用 emoji 表情符号,提供了一种只需查看使用的表情符号来识别提交的目的或意图的简单方法。这里有足够的表情符号供你不同的需求。

使用效果:

git命令思维导图

公众号回复【git】获取git命令思维导图高清pdf。

end

猜你喜欢

Linux内核死锁检测工具——Lockdep

Linux内核基础篇——常用调试技巧汇总

Linux内核基础篇——动态输出调试

Linux内核基础篇——printk调试

Linux内核基础篇——initcall

RISC-V SiFive U64内核——HPM硬件性能监视器

RISC-V SiFive U64内核——L2 Prefetcher预取器

RISC-V SiFive U54内核——PMP物理内存保护

RISC-V SiFive U54内核——PLIC平台级中断控制器

RISC-V SiFive U54内核——CLINT中断控制器

RISC-V SiFive U54内核——中断和异常详解

实战 | RISC-V Linux入口地址2M预留内存优化

RISC-V Linux启动之页表创建分析

RISC-V Linux汇编启动过程分析

教你在QEMU上运行RISC-V Linux

OpenSBI三种固件的区别

写给新手的MMU工作原理

相关文章
|
9月前
|
开发工具 git
git问题
git问题
48 0
|
9月前
|
开发工具 git
git blame
git blame 是一个 Git 命令,用于显示某个文件中每一行代码的修改历史。它会显示每行代码的最后一次修改者、修改日期和修改内容。通过 git blame 命令,你可以轻松追踪代码的修改记录,了解团队成员在开发过程中的协作情况。
226 10
|
9月前
|
Linux 开发工具 数据安全/隐私保护
版本控制器Git
版本控制器Git
80 0
|
9月前
|
Linux 开发工具 git
git初识
git初识
53 0
|
存储 Java Linux
Git 2.41 is here!
* Git 作为一个开源项目刚刚发布了 [2.41 版本](https://lore.kernel.org/git/xmqqleh3a3wm.fsf@gitster.g/ "2.41 版本"),其中共有 95 位开发者贡献了新的特性以及已有缺陷的修复,而他们中的 29 位是新的贡献者。我们上次聊到 Git 的最新发布动态是在[Git 2.40 版本](https://github.blog/202
|
存储 开发工具 git
Git(超详细)
1.Git概述 Git简介 Git是一个分布式版本控制工具,通常用来对软件开发过程中的源代码文件进行管理。通过Git仓库来存储和管理这些文件,Git仓库分为两种: 本地仓库:开发人员自己电脑上的Git 仓库 远程仓库:远程服务器上的Git仓库
|
开发工具 git
git简单总结
git简单总结
|
存储 安全 Linux
|
开发工具 git
Git 这些小技巧你知道吗?
Git 这些小技巧你知道吗?
144 0
Git 这些小技巧你知道吗?
|
缓存 JSON Linux
git
-
299 0

热门文章

最新文章

相关实验场景

更多